- Sulphur Springs. Aug. [August] 13/45 [1945].
Rode up from corners in 2 3/4 hrs [hours]. Fine
very hot day.
In afternoon worked the adjacent
gullies + hiked back to the summit
between here + the Red Deer.
Plenty of elk sign everywhere, including
tracks of cows + calves on the trail
just west of the boundary.
Looking across river it looks as if
a quick + easy route to the Dormer
is readily accessible. Ride up first creek
below camp into meadows, pass to head
of meadows then swing west around
base of grassy knoll + drop down
to Dormer - perhaps 5 miles total distance
Range here is in excellent condition
+ has improved since I was last here
In places it has been heavily used
but is standing up well.
Game seen 1 moose
5 deer.
